It is with great pleasure that we announce the publication of the limited 
edition of "The Writing on the Wall: A Catalogue of Judaica Broadsides from the 
Valmadonna Trust Library."
 
The Valmadonna Trust Library is the world's single most important and extensive 
private collection of Hebrew books. Assembled by Mr. Jack Lunzer, the 
indefatigable Custodian of the Library, the collection comprises thousands of 
rare volumes from virtually all corners of the Jewish world. Within this vast 
collection are more than 550 broadsides; primarily single sheets of paper 
printed on one side for public distribution or posting. These important 
documentary sources for the history of the Jews in the early modern era, have 
never been afforded a systematic scholarly treatment, until now. This 
groundbreaking volume includes 554 catalogue entries which provide essential 
information and concise descriptions of each broadside in the Collection. 
Featuring scholarly essays by Dvora Bregman, Elisheva Carlebach, Ruth Langer, 
and Nahum Rakover, all leading academics in their respective fields, whose 
areas of research have in the past made extensive use of the types of material 
found in the Valmadonna Collection. These essays provide the reader with a 
richer contextualization and a fuller understanding of the catalogued 
materials. Thirty-six highlighted broadsides feature full-color images and more 
comprehensive narratives, augmented by English translations for the benefit of 
the lay reader. Additional material includes a numerical conversion chart for 
the cross-referencing of catalogue numbers with preexisting Valmadonna 
Collection reference numbers, an index of first lines of poems, and a general 
index. The publisher has made full-color high-resolution images of all the 
broadsides available on a complementary, dedicated website, enabling scholars 
to undertake their own detailed examinations of these broadsides, thus 
facilitating a more nuanced comprehension and an even greater appreciation of 
the Collection as a whole. From these examinations, new perspectives will 
emerge and new connections will be seen.
